What they do
A Bartender mixes and prepares cocktails and serves drinks to customers. Works with other wait staff in a bar or restaurant; checks to be sure that customers are legal drinking age. May work at private parties.
$29,930 / year median in Utah
+25% projected growth
Job Description
Stocks bar, mixes and serves alcoholic beverages, assists in cost control, inventory and maintains inventory records. Assists department leaders with creation of seasonal cocktails and development of menu Assists department leaders with Social Media schedule and creation of content Maintains inventory control through conscientious use and careful monitoring of all food and beverage products. Communicates with management in a timely manner when supplies are needed. Ensure compliance with applicable state liquor laws and standard operating procedures provided by the management. Communicates guest requests and concerns to the Department Manager. Performs opening and closing duties which include, but are not limited to inventory, cash control, cleaning, and restocking. Accountable for checks and cash transactions. Utilizes Point of Sales System. Reviews banquet schedule for changes, calendar of events, and special events. Serve catered parties from service or portable bars. On occasion will serve meals to guests. Incorporates safe work practices in job performance. Regular and reliable attendance. Performs other duties as required.
